As many of you will know with deep regret we were told that this week Mary Markham a league Vice President secretary of Webbys' Wanderers, and long standing committee member, sadly past away at 5.00pm on Tuesday.
Needless to say our thoughts are with Mary's husband Geoff, her sons Neil (Oily) & Shaun (Noose) and the rest of the family at this sad time. Mary had been battling against illness for some time, and was recently diagnosed with leukemia.
Having spoken to both Oily & Noose they have asked if their home game against East Goscote this Sunday can still go ahead, this will be a difficult day for all associated with Webbys but Mary wouldn't want it any other way.
Mary has been involved with Magna Town and Webbys since 1981 and been an incredible servant to local football and the Alliance League, so many players, friends and footballing colleagues have found memories of Mary. Oily, Webbys current manager, would like to welcome as many people as possible that knew Mary to come down to the game (Horsewell Lane, Little Hill Estate, Wigston) and pay tribute to Mary with a minutes silence and a minutes applause before the game tomorrow.
In addition a minutes silence will be observed at all Alliance League games
